Following last week's discussion of the rounding drift in the Velgrim-to-Talren conversions, the service now performs all arithmetic in scaled integers and applies banker's rounding only at display time. Two variables control this: `COINWARD_SCALE_DIGITS` (default 6) and `COINWARD_ROUND_MODE` (default `half_even`). Both are read at startup from the standard env file. The reconciliation job that verifies daily totals against the rates provider authenticates separately, and its credential must appear in the same file on the following line:

secret setting of hawep-yahig: LEDGER_TOKEN29=41b5d6315371c92885eaeb077fb63

# Limits & Quotas — Batchwise Scaler

The recipe-scaling calculator enforces hard caps to keep the solver bounded. Max ingredients per recipe, max scale factor, and max nested sub-recipes are all fixed at the API layer; exceeding any returns a 422. Quotas are per-tenant, reset hourly. Don't raise them ad hoc — the unit-conversion graph grows quadratically with ingredient count, and we've melted the worker pool twice. Requests for higher limits go through capacity review. Current enforced values are defined in config as follows.

tuning table, hafog-bahaf:
QUOTAS = {
    "praion": 144,
    "briax": 906,
    "silwyn": 451,
}

Before approving changes to the graph-rendering module, verify three things: the cycle-detection pass still runs before layout (reordering it causes silent truncation of large graphs), the node cache is invalidated on manifest changes, and the export job completes within its five-minute budget on the Ravensmoor reference dataset. If any check fails, block the merge and flag the authoring team. Expected outputs, test fixtures, and the reviewer checklist are kept on the internal page.

wiki page, fahaf-yagag: https://confluence.qorvellabs.internal/pages/display/pages/display

## Configuration

Driftrelay retries failed webhook deliveries with exponential backoff: attempts at 30s, 2m, 10m, then hourly up to 24 hours. Set RETRY_MAX_ATTEMPTS to cap this, and RETRY_JITTER_PCT to spread load after downstream outages. Deliveries are considered failed on any non-2xx response or a 10-second timeout. Every outbound request is signed so receivers can verify it came from us, and the signer reads its credential from the env file on this line:

env line for fafof-fahag: LEDGER_TOKEN5=f8790